Ver Mensaje Individual
  #2 (permalink)  
Antiguo 12/04/2012, 03:10
Avatar de Fuzzylog
Fuzzylog
 
Fecha de Ingreso: agosto-2008
Ubicación: En internet
Mensajes: 2.511
Antigüedad: 15 años, 8 meses
Puntos: 188
Respuesta: Hibernate (Editar clave foranea)

No entiendo muy bien qué es lo que pretendes hacer, pero no se yo si está bien referenciado desde customer:

El fecth es la forma de acceder: select, join, etc... puedes pasar de ella
class es la ruta completa de la clase: ruta package + Clase

<many-to-one name="adress" class="tu.package.donde.esta.Address" fetch="select">
<column name="address_id" not-null="true">
<comment>Puedes agregar un comentario sobre la columna.</comment>
</column>
</many-to-one>

Para modificar la clave puedes seleccionar otra columna :/
Si a lo que te refieres es a alterar el valor de la clave deberias hacerlo directamente desde adress y teniendo en cuenta que son claves únicas (esto es más peligroso que lo primero)
__________________
if (fuzzy && smooth) {
fuzzylog = "c00l";
return true;
}